Herb

Aloe


Parts Used: Fresh or dehydrated juice from the leaves
May be used internally where a poerful cathartic is needed. In a small doasage it increases the menstrual flow. Externally the juice is used fresh for minor burns, sunburn, incsect bites, etc. 
As Aloe stimulates uterine contractions, it should be avoided during pregnancy. As it is excreted in the mother's milk, it should be avoided during breastfeeding, or it may be a purgative to the child. 


Rune

Uruz

The rune of the wild ox, Aurochs. It represents the vital, wild force, and energy of the hardy wild ox. 
Considered to be a powerful indicator of good health and strong natural powers of resistance, where health is an issue this rune shows a speedy recovery from the illness or affliction. It also represents the true will of the querent, showing the thing that he truely desires. 
Reversed it shows that you are about to fail or have already failed to take advantage of the moment.
